What is a cryptocurrency casino?
A crypto casino is an online gambling site which uses cryptocurrency (like Bitcoin or Ethereum) to make deposits, bet or withdraw money–similarly to using either a credit card or an electronic wallet, but via blockchain transactions.
Bitcoin casinos explained (BTC as opposed to other coins)
Bitcoin: widely supported, however fees and confirmation time differ based on network conditions.
ETH: can be more costly during times of congestion
Stablecoins (e.g., USDT): reduce price volatility when compared with BTC/ETH. But they make use of blockchain rails
The key point is that “speed” comes from a mix of the casino’s approval time + confirmations from networks (and charges)

anonymous crypto casinos and “no-KYC” reality check
“Anonymous” as well as “no KYC” are typically used as a shorthand for sign-ups with low-friction. In reality, most operators make use of risk-based verification and will ask for documents when triggers occur (larger withdrawals as well as unusual activities, AML/security checks in addition to bonus verifications).
When KYC typically results in
First major withdrawal
Bonus cashouts / audits of wagering
multiple accounts/devices/IP changes
suspected fraud / chargeback risk (for fiat rails)
Safer choice for privacy-conscious users (without falsehoods)
select brands that adhere to clear rules as well as clear operator details
Make an small withdrawal as a test earlier (to check the actual processing behaviour)
Beware of mixing payment methods avoid mixing multiple payment methods unless permitted by the terms
Fees and payouts (deposits withdraws, deposits, network costs)
What will you see on the surface:
Fees for network: charges for the blockchain are determined by coin/network and congestion
Casino processing: A few sites charge or embed fees into limits/spreads
Exchange spreads: converting fiat-crypto can be a hidden cost
Minimums smaller withdrawals can be blocked by limits on minimum withdrawals
Risk of volatility Price movements in BTC/ETH may change what is the “real actual value” between withdrawal and deposit

Do crypto casinos make payments instantly?
Not assured. Payout time = casino processing + blockchain confirmations plus any security/AML checks.
Do I need an ID for a crypto-casino?
Often not at registration, but verification may occur later (withdrawal size, suspicious activity, the audit of bonuses).
Are “no KYC” crypto casinos are really secure?
Usually “low-friction” is what you get. Numerous operators retain the right to verify identity under certain conditions.
What are the coins that UK online casinos use?
Commonly BTC and ETH, in addition to stablecoins such as USDT (coin/network availability varies according to operator).
Are stablecoins superior to Bitcoin when it comes to gambling?
Stablecoins are able to reduce the risk of price volatility relative to BTC/ETH. However, they have to pay network fees as well as operator rules.
Why is my cryptocurrency withdrawal currently pending?
Common reasons include internal processing lines, a second security review as well as bonus wagering checks. limitations on withdrawals, or confirmation delays.
Can bonuses slow down the withdrawal process?
Yes–bonuses often trigger extra checks (wagering audits limit bet requirements, banned games, Max cashout limits).

Can I use GAMSTOP in conjunction with crypto casinos located offshore?
GAMSTOP blocks access to online casinos that are licensed in Great Britain (UKGC-licensed). Online casinos that are offshore are not necessarily covered.
